Global oil prices rise

Global oil prices remained stable on Monday despite a combination of factors weighing heavily on quotes, Report informs referring to trading data.
The price of March Brent crude futures rose 0.05% from the previous close to $65.91 per barrel, while March WTI futures rose a similarly symbolic 0.08% to $61.12.
Late last week, US President Donald Trump told reporters that American warships were heading toward Iran.
Trump threatened to use force against Iran in response to the harsh suppression of days-long protests.
Earlier, the US Department of Energy published data on the country's oil reserves and production. US oil production fell by 21,000 barrels per day to 13.732 million barrels per day in the week ending January 16.
